换手率是衡量股票流通性强弱的重要指标,它反映了市场上股票的买卖活跃程度。掌握换手率的计算公式和源码技巧,对于投资者来说至关重要。本文将详细介绍换手率的计算方法,并分享如何轻松掌握股票换手率的源码技巧。
一、换手率的定义
换手率是指在一定时间内,股票的成交量与总股本的比例。它通常用来衡量股票的流通性,即股票在市场上的交易活跃程度。换手率越高,说明股票流通性越好,投资者买卖意愿强烈。
二、换手率的计算公式
换手率的计算公式如下:
[ \text{换手率} = \frac{\text{某一时段的成交量}}{\text{总股本}} \times 100\% ]
其中:
- 某一时段的成交量:指的是在特定时间段内股票的成交量,通常以手为单位。
- 总股本:指的是公司的总股份数,通常以股为单位。
示例
假设某股票在某一时段的成交量为100万手,总股本为1亿股,则其换手率为:
[ \text{换手率} = \frac{100万手}{1亿股} \times 100\% = 10\% ]
这意味着在这段时间内,该股票的流通性较好。
三、换手率的源码技巧
掌握换手率的源码技巧,可以帮助投资者快速、准确地计算股票的换手率。以下是一些常用的源码技巧:
1. 使用Python进行换手率计算
Python是一种功能强大的编程语言,可以轻松实现换手率的计算。以下是一个简单的Python代码示例:
def calculate_turnover_rate(trading_volume, total_shares):
turnover_rate = (trading_volume / total_shares) * 100
return turnover_rate
# 示例
trading_volume = 10000000 # 成交量(手)
total_shares = 100000000 # 总股本(股)
turnover_rate = calculate_turnover_rate(trading_volume, total_shares)
print("换手率:{}%".format(turnover_rate))
2. 使用Excel函数计算换手率
Excel是一款强大的数据处理工具,其中包含了许多实用的函数。以下是一个使用Excel函数计算换手率的示例:
- 在Excel中输入以下公式:
=TRUNC((B2/A2)*100,2),其中B2为成交量,A2为总股本。 - 按下回车键,即可计算出换手率。
3. 使用编程语言进行换手率计算
除了Python和Excel,其他编程语言如Java、C#等也可以轻松实现换手率的计算。以下是一个使用Java进行换手率计算的示例:
public class TurnoverRate {
public static void main(String[] args) {
double tradingVolume = 10000000; // 成交量(手)
double totalShares = 100000000; // 总股本(股)
double turnoverRate = (tradingVolume / totalShares) * 100;
System.out.println("换手率:{}%".format(turnoverRate));
}
}
四、总结
掌握换手率的计算公式和源码技巧,有助于投资者更好地了解股票的流通性。通过本文的介绍,相信您已经对换手率的计算方法有了深入的了解。在实际操作中,可以根据自己的需求选择合适的计算方法和工具,以便更高效地掌握股票换手率。
